Public Universities in Sumy
1. Sumy State University
Sumy State University is one of Ukraine’s most renowned institutions. Its excellence is highly acclaimed, whether nationally or globally. Besides its education quality, what makes SumDu distinct is the many options it offers. For instance, students can choose from English or Ukrainian-taught programs. They can also pursue specific courses on-campus or in distance learning mode. A broad range of disciplines is also encompassed by the undergraduate and grad programs it provides. Such relative flexibility allows the university to attract thousands of students, even from across the globe.
2. Sumy National Agrarian University
Sumy National Agrarian University is committed to its namesake field, agriculture. But it takes agricultural education to a different dimension by incorporating other disciplines, such as foreign languages and computer science. Such a move (along with ensuring that its educators are the best specialists in their field) allows the university to produce a unique and holistic generation of agricultural experts.
3. Sumy State Pedagogical University
Sumy State Pedagogical University, named after A.S. Makarenko (SSPU), is a public university in Sumy, Ukraine. It was founded in 1924 and is ranked among the top 90 educational institutions in Ukraine. SSPU also provides students with academic and non-academic facilities and services, such as a library and administrative services.

1. Can International Students Study in Public Universities in Sumy?
Absolutely! International students in public universities in Sumy can pursue different program levels, but the most popular ones are bachelor’s and master’s programs.
As for tuition fees, note that these vary across specific disciplines and program levels, with some charging significantly more than others. Specifically, public universities in Sumy charge up to 73,900 UAH for bachelor’s and 81,300 UAH for master’s studies.
